Lake Jackson RV Campground & Park, located in Covington County, Alabama, just a few miles from the Florida state line, is a natural wonderland that draws visitors from both Alabama and Florida year-round. One of the park’s most unique features is its namesake, Lake Jackson. This natural freshwater lake covers 500 acres and has a maximum depth of 18 feet, offering visitors a variety of recreational activities, including fishing, boating, and swimming. The lake is also surrounded by scenic hiking trails that offer stunning views of the water and surrounding landscape.

Lake Jackson RV Campground & Park is also home to a campground with 28 campsites equipped with water and electricity, some of which offer a lakefront view. There are also three cabins available for rent, each with its own kitchen and bathroom facilities. The park is open year-round, but the summer months tend to be the busiest due to warmer weather and school vacations. If you prefer a quieter experience, consider visiting in the spring or fall when the weather is mild, and the crowds are smaller.

The park also hosts a variety of seasonal events throughout the year, such as a Christmas light display during the holiday season. Visitors can also explore the Florala Memorial Park, located within the park grounds, which commemorates the service of veterans from Covington County and includes a memorial wall, an honor walk, and a patriotic gazebo. Another must-see attraction is the Geneva County Covered Bridge, a historic bridge built in 1900 that spans the Choctawhatchee River and offers stunning views of the water and surrounding countryside.

For those interested in outdoor recreation, Lake Jackson RV Campground & Park has plenty to offer, including a playground, picnic area, and several miles of hiking trails that wind through the park’s forests and offer opportunities to see wildlife such as deer, squirrels, and birds. The park also has a boat ramp, making it easy to launch your own watercraft and explore the lake at your leisure.

Finally, Lake Jackson RV Campground & Park is located just a short drive from several other popular attractions in the area, including the Gulf Coast beaches, which are just an hour’s drive away, and the nearby town of Andalusia, which offers a variety of shopping and dining options, as well as historic sites such as the Three Notch Museum.
